Runbook: Migrating Corvid services to the Hadrell hermetic build

New team members: all Corvid builds are moving off the shared toolchain. Pin every dependency in the manifest; network fetches at build time now fail the job. Run the hermetic build locally before pushing — cache misses are expected on first run. If outputs differ from legacy, diff the toolchain versions first. Seed your local builder with the configuration below.

settings of fafog-haduf:
ZORIX_PIN=4648
ZORIX_METRICS_HOST=metrics.zorix.paliqsys.corp
ZORIX_LOG_LEVEL=info
ZORIX_TENANT=druix

# Data Stores — ChipGate Reader

ChipGate is the timing-chip reader service used at the Varnholm Marathon. Each mat scan is written first to a local ring buffer, then flushed to the central results database every two seconds. The results database holds split times, bib mappings, and reader health metrics. Contractors should never write directly to the buffer; all corrections go through the results store. For read access during your engagement, use the connection string below.

database URL for haduf-tajof: redis://holox_svc:c9@db-3fb6.lumicworks.local:5432/fraeth

### Log sampling on Pipewren

When Pipewren floods the aggregator, enable sampling via the admin API rather than restarting the service. Set sample_rate to 0.1 for bursts, restore to 1.0 afterward, and note the change in the ops journal. The sampling endpoint requires authentication; use the bearer token below.

bearer token for kawig-yajef: eyJhbGciOiJIUzI1NiIsInR5cCI6IkpXVCJ9.eyJzdWIiOiI8HQhnz97dxIn0.tsXu5Xf2tmo0

Hi Odette — flagging this for your review. Our dependency pinning policy requires every lockfile change in the Tidemark repo to carry a valid signature, but CI started rejecting the manifest yesterday with "untrusted signer." Turns out the pipeline rotated its verification keys last sprint and the policy doc never got updated, so everything signed since then trips the check. Nothing malicious as far as I can tell — just drift. For your audit, the currently active signing key is below.

release key, fajef-kajeg: bky19_LdLu6Ne6FLi8he2c24d